Christopher Vance is a talented actor, best known for his lead role as Frank Martin in Transporter: The Series. He has also made a name for himself in other notable roles, including Whistler in Prison Break and Jack Gallagher in Mental.
Born into a loving Irish family and raised in the UK, Vance began his career in football, signing youth contracts with West Bromwich Albion and Bristol Rovers. However, he eventually turned to acting, graduating from the University of Newcastle-Upon-Tyne with an honors degree in Civil Engineering.
Vance's early acting career was marked by several roles in productions of Romeo & Juliet and other plays, as well as appearances on the London Fringe and in small Reparatory Theatres. He also launched his own theatre company, writing, directing, and producing plays.
Vance's big break came when he landed his first real gig at the Royal National Theatre in a touring version of the play "Closer." He went on to appear in several other productions, including "Speer" by David Edgar, and made his British television debut in the show "Kavanagh QC."
In the early 2000s, Vance moved to Australia and performed in several television series, including "Stingers," "Blue Heelers," and "The Secret Life of Us." He then moved to the U.S. and booked a regular role in the hit TV series "Prison Break," playing James Whistler.
Vance has also appeared in several other TV shows, including "Mental," "Fairly Legal," "Burn Notice," "Dexter," "Rizzoli and Isles," "Supergirl," "Hawaii 5-O," and "Bosch." In addition to his acting career, Vance has also written a series of novels bound in historical fiction and fairy-tale.
